BACKGROUND
The Author has written and/or created the Work.
The Producer wishes:
to obtain an exclusive option over certain specified rights to the Work; and
if it chooses, to exercise the Option; and
to be entitled to develop the Work to the extent necessary to enable it to apply to funding bodies for funding of a production version of the Work; and
to be entitled to so apply to funding bodies.
The Author has agreed to grant the Producer such rights subject to the terms and conditions set out in this Agreement.

DEFINITIONS and interpretation
Definitions: In this Agreement the following terms shall have the meanings specified:
Development Work means the preparation of such storylines, scenarios, scripts, screenplays, presentations, treatments and other adaptations of the Work as are reasonably necessary in order to produce the Revised Work and may extend to adding, deleting or otherwise altering the title, characters, plots, theme, dialogue, sequences, situations, or storyline of the Work.
